2010 · 1 incident

April 5, 2010 AL · Metal/Non-Metal laborer, blacksmith, bull gang, parts runner, roustabout, pick-up man, pitman HANDLING OF MATERIALS
Lafarge Aggregates Southeast Inc · Caught in, under or between (Not Elsewhere Classified)

After cleaning out a rail car, employee went to close the latch. In attempting to secure the latch he pushed on it with his hand, the latch came loose and pinned his left ring finger. He received several lacerations which required 12 stitches.

2007 · 1 incident

August 2, 2007 AL · Metal/Non-Metal mechanic helper HANDTOOLS (NONPOWERED)
Lafarge Aggregates Southeast Inc · Struck by... (Not Elsewhere Classified)

Employee was doing repair work on a Motor Control Center and wrench slipped off connection and struck employee's safety glasses which broke cutting him above his left eye. The cut required stitches.
